Output f85d08a660aedcbfc5fb5f1e2f17ce8d6c4038221c2bcfe51c20627a2c727096:107

value
57873
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ca3a09b9d2c61892861a0452546a52f785ddca7 OP_EQUALVERIFY OP_CHECKSIG
address
16XdZYGb7PuY8iThW8mgW4PcW5aASqBJA4
transaction
f85d08a660aedcbfc5fb5f1e2f17ce8d6c4038221c2bcfe51c20627a2c727096
spent
true